UHS is currently recruiting for our Market CFO for our Acute Care operations in our South Carolina / Florida region, based out of Wellington, FL. This region includes Aiken Regional Medical Center, Wellington Regional Medical Center, Lakewood Ranch Medical Center, Manatee Memorial Hospital and other entities that are part of our acute division.

The CFO - Market Acute oversees the financial operations and performance of the region and works in close partnership with the Group VP and the SVP Finance for our acute Division. Plans, organizes, and directs the Market's finance departments, including the development, interpretation, coordination, and administration of policies on finance, accounting, insurance, financial/accounting systems, internal controls, admitting and utilization review. This position is a critical thought partner to the GVP on the development and execution of integrated delivery network strategies which will drive long term success in the respective region.

The job responsibilities will include:

  • Oversees the Market's accounting, business office, materials management, medical records, information services, and other departments as assigned. Through department heads and supervisors, monitors market performance. Establishes communication systems to inform and be informed as needed.
  • Supervises the market's financial reporting process. Supervises the preparation of reports outlining financial position and operating profit and loss statement. Supervises the preparation and timely filing of federal, state, hospital association, third party, and other financial reports as required.
  • Maximizes market operational performance. Analyzes the profitability of existing operations, product lines, contractual agreements, etc., making recommendations when appropriate for improvement.
  • Manages and develops employees. Through appropriate management practices, creates a climate to motivate employees to highest performance. Establishes direction, coaches employees, provides feedback, and builds commitment.

Qualifications

Job Requirements:

  • To be considered for this role, you must possess a working knowledge of GAAP, Medicare and Medicaid regulations, and federal and local tax regulations; knowledge of all business office and other administrative office operations including all processes from registration to cash collection; knowledge of managed care and other payer processes and agreements, including specific terms for negotiation are required; knowledge of all accounting processes including accounts payable, payroll and general accounting and effective ability to prepare financial statements and operating reports that accurately and timely reflect the entity's performance.
  • Must be skilled at interpreting the abstract pieces of financial analysis and performance; preparing schedules and reports, using source data and compiling reports from others' schedules; skill in use of electronic spreadsheets and ability to manipulate data within proprietary and acquired data bases; adept at skillfully communicating ideas and facts, packaging information and concepts in a way that increases understanding by others.
  • You must possess a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, or other closely-related field and a minimum of 8 years of relevant progressive financial experience with a healthcare organization. The ideal candidate will possess a Master's degree in Accounting, Finance, or other closely-related field, with a minimum of 10 years of progressive financial experience within an acute care setting.
